I've done an index for the Technical Orientation (how many days could I have saved if this had existed when I started out!!!) - not sure who is doing these on YouTube now, but I'm putting it all on the associated wiki page:
0:00 Introduction to the topics in the video
0:25 Where is EPrints installed? (Ubuntu / Debian style)
0:36 Using the Apache configuration file to find EPrints
2:05 What is EPrints? (as a system)
2:17 Finding the database (default file)
2:40 Checking for overrides to the default file
3:40 Looking at the database
3:57 Listing tables in the database
4:05 The EPrint table (non-multiple fields)
4:21 Finding tables holding multiple fields
6:06 The cfg.d directory
6:25 Simple and complex configurations
7:13 eprint_render.pl - changing abstract pages
7:35 views.pl - changing browse views
7:45 Best practice for customising configuration settings
8:20 Adding a new field in a new configuration file
9:15 Using diff to check local configuration files against default configuration files
10:00 Benefits of using separate files when upgrading
10:21 The /bin directory
10:35 epadmin - some common functions
11:25 Default configuration files for a new archive
11:53 Global (all archives) settings in the /lib directory
12:37 Overriding global configurations for an archive (Templates example)
14:51 Reloading the repository to show changes
15:28 Making changes to phrases (displayed text)
17:35 The /archives directory
17:53 Inside an archive directory
18:03 The archive /documents directory
24:01 Finding the documents for a specific EPrint
26:00 System generated documents (previews)
26:23 History of an EPrint - Revision files in the /revisions directory
27:04 Static files in /html
28:41 Static files in /cfg/lang/[en]/static and cfg/static
31:12 Running generate_static to refresh html pages (and --prune option to remove)
31:57 Citations - where to find them
32:30 Plugins - where to find them
34:06 Plugins - where to create a directory for Archive-specific plugins
